Until November 2, 2026, RBC is running an interesting promotion when you open an eligible chequing account: you can get an Apple iPad (11-inch, Wi-Fi, 128 GB, a $499 value) if you meet every condition of the offer.

The two accounts eligible for this offer are the RBC Signature No Limit Banking Account and the RBC VIP Banking Package.
The RBC Signature No Limit Banking Account is a good fit for anyone who wants a full-featured chequing account with unlimited debit transactions in Canada, up to 3 non-RBC ATM fees waived per month, and savings of up to $48 on the annual fee of an eligible credit card.
The RBC VIP Banking Package is aimed more at people who want broader banking privileges, with unlimited debit transactions worldwide, no monthly fees on up to two additional Canadian dollar accounts and one eligible U.S. dollar account, and savings of up to $120 on the annual fee of an eligible credit card.
In short, both accounts give access to the iPad promotion, but choosing the right package will come down mostly to your banking habits and to the value you place on the benefits included.

According to RBC, this offer targets eligible new clients. If you already have a personal RBC bank account, or if you have already received a similar account-opening offer in the past five years, you may not be eligible. RBC also specifies that simply switching packages does not qualify for this promotion.
It is therefore important to read the full terms before opening an account.

This RBC offer is worthwhile for anyone who was already planning to open a new chequing account and who can easily meet the required conditions.
Instead of cash back or points, the current offer gives you a tangible gift: an iPad worth $499. For some people, that can represent more concrete immediate value than a traditional bank bonus.
Keep in mind, though, that the real value of the offer depends on the account you choose, the monthly fees you pay, and your ability to maintain the account and the eligible activities under RBC’s conditions.
In other words, this promotion can be appealing, but it is mostly worthwhile if the account also suits you beyond the welcome gift.
